This is my fourth card using Julee's 400th sketch. The die cut coffee cup and steam is from an older cricut cartridge "Beyond birthdays, my paper is Basic Grey. The sentiment is from Verve "Remember this" along with verve sequins. the ink is from CTMH. Because the print had such a homey look I decided to add the stitching around the corners.

This is my third card using this sketch, so I thought I would shake things up a bit and flip the layout one turn clockwise. To make things even more exciting, the sentiment I used is an older Verve stamp set from 2008 called "Thankful Blossoms". I also used White Deliquesce from Creative inspirations paint. The banner is from Banner Bundle die set. The paper collection is Basic Grey "Freshly cut" Of course I had to add the beautiful aqua signature color sequins from verve.
